Question:
During reinstallation of the upper and lower storage plates, Im encountering alignment issues between the bolt hole and the plates. The springs make it challenging to maintain proper positioning, which complicates the insertion of the tow bars and bolt. Any suggestions would be most appreciated.
asked by: Rob G
Expert Reply:
Hey Rob!
Try getting everything mostly in place and then using the bolt to finally position everything up and you insert the bolt. Check out the 3:20 minute mark on the linked video of the Replacement Storage Plate # DM25VR to see what I'm talking about.
Does that help out at all?
